Subject: Scheduled key rotation — Schemakeep registry

Hello support team,

On Thursday we will rotate the credential that support tooling uses to query the Schemakeep event schema registry. The old key stops working at 09:00 sharp; lookups made with it will return 401s, not stale data, so please don't escalate those as registry outages. Update your saved sessions beforehand. The replacement key is below.

API key for yahig-tadup: kto7_ubizbYm

### 3.8.2 — Key rotation for pinned-dependency verification

Reviewer note: this release rotates the key used to sign our lockfile attestations under the Harrowgate pinning policy. All dependencies remain pinned to exact versions; the rotation changes only the trust anchor consumed by the CI verifier. Please confirm the verifier config references the new fingerprint and that the old key is marked revoked in the manifest. The replacement signing key is included below for your review.

deploy key for kajof-fajop: bky6_gDHw9Q

For the weekly eng sync: the Tidewatch widget on the Seabright dashboard continues displaying the previous day's high-tide entries until a manual refresh. The rollover job fires correctly, but the widget's cache key still includes yesterday's date string, so the fresh table is never fetched. Reproduced on both staging and the Port Ellery demo tenant. Proposed fix: derive the cache key from the server-provided table date rather than the client clock. The affected build's trace token is recorded below.

session token of yahof-bajeg = htk9_0d43d44ed